Centrifugal slurry pumps are designed to handle a mixture of solid particles and liquids, which makes them susceptible to wear and tear. This wear predominantly impacts parts that come into direct contact with the slurry, necessitating regular replacements. Some of the most critical spare parts include the impeller, liner, shaft sleeve, and bearing assembly. Each component plays a crucial role in the pump's performance and longevity, and selecting high-quality spares can significantly extend the pump's lifespan. The impeller is often regarded as the heart of a centrifugal slurry pump. It is responsible for moving the slurry through the pump and into the discharge pipe. Impellers are typically made from high-chrome alloys or materials with superior abrasion resistance. Selecting the right impeller type and material is critical, as it can significantly affect the pump's efficiency and wear rate. In industries where downtime is costly, investing in a high-quality impeller not only enhances performance but also reduces long-term operational costs.

Another vital component is the pump liner, which acts as a protective barrier between the casing and the slurry. Liners are designed to be sacrificial elements that absorb the wear caused by the abrasive slurry, hence prolonging the life of the pump casing itself. Like impellers, liners must be selected based on the specific requirements of the application, including the abrasiveness and corrosiveness of the fluid handled. Advanced materials such as synthetic rubber or hard metals are commonly used to manufacture liners for enhanced durability. The shaft sleeve also requires attention. It protects the pump shaft from wear caused by the abrasive slurry. The selection of the right shaft sleeve material is critical to ensure a long operational life and reduce maintenance costs. Materials such as stainless steel or ceramic-coated sleeves are popular choices due to their superior resistance to abrasion and corrosion.centrifugal slurry pump spares
Bearings and their assembly components are other crucial elements that ensure the smooth operation of a centrifugal slurry pump. The proper lubrication and maintenance of bearings can prevent unexpected failures, which can lead to costly downtimes. A comprehensive understanding of the bearing requirements, matched with regular maintenance schedules, can greatly enhance the reliability of slurry pumping systems.
